Description <itemDescription>
  • Moulded male head; oval face; straight hair, combed downwards, indicated by striations; almond shaped eyes; faintly smiling mouth; dimple in the chin; the back part is smoothed and taller than the front, forming a ridge at junction between front and back. Light red clay; reddish yellow slip.
Inventory number <itemDescription>
Acquisition <itemDescription>
  • Purchased in 1958 from G. De Parri (the landowner of the excavated area) by the intermediary of the Swedish Institute at Rome and with a grant from King Gustaf VI Adolf.
Condition <itemDescription>
  • Large part of base missing. Ridge and tip of the nose chipped. Root marks. Burn marks (?).
